Business Case one:

Smart application to monitor cars movement and telemetry

AB Pty. Ltd is a delivery company who has 20 trucks to deliver different products for third party. They have their set delivery zone which covers entire Cairns CBD, QlD, Australia. Because of the expanding demand their trucks are always busy. Most recently, they are receiving complaining about delayed delivery and long queue of pending delivery. Initial stage of their business a truck in average can deliver 5 times a day. However, current average for their truck is only 3. More over many of their truck is having unexpected breakdown which is prolonging the existing queue. The general manager of AB Pty. Ltd appointed a business analyst to identify potential improvements require to resolve raising issues and to make the business ready for future growth. The business analyst make two main recommendations, one of them is to develop a smart application to efficiently use available trucks.

The details report for smart ICT application recommendation is below:

- Device the entire delivery area in four zone ( east, west, south and east)
- Divide your entire car fleet in four groups and allocate each group to each zone.
- Any movement of the vehicle outside of their zone should be tracked.
- The application should collect the telemetry of the vehicle periodically to check current status and possible repair requirements
[Optional]
- It will be good if the application can track the movement of the truck within the zone too

The AB Pty. Ltd appointed you as an ICT professional to develop connected smart vehicle application for simulation in Bluemix.

Business Case Two:

Smart application to remotely monitor a patient's movement details

AB hospital has a physiotherapy department with 20 patients. The hospital is very renowned for their services. It is receiving increasing pressure to increase their capacity to serve more physiotherapy patients. They have appointed a business analyst to identify possible service issues may occur if they increase their capacity to serve 50 + patients at a time which is more than double than the current number. The analyst identified three main possible issues and one of them was to monitor patient's movement. Tracking 50 + patients movement manually is cumbersome and not feasible. The hospital management decided to develop a smart application to track movement of their patients. The application will be able to perform following tasks -

- Track the movement of a patient with in a walking area

- It will collect movement statistic like speed, distance walked, etc

- Implement a visualization dashboard which display all the corrected statistics for doctors to see.

- It will alert the hospital authority if they move outside the walking zone [Optional]

- Post a message in Twitter if they finish their required walking limit
